A comunicação BGP usa quatro tipos de mensagem OPEN, UPDATE, NOTIFICATION, KEEPALIVE conforme explico cada uma abaixo:
1 – OPEN – A mensagem OPEN é usada para estabelecer uma adjacência BGP. A mensagem OPEN contém o número da versão do BGP, ASN do roteador de origem, Hold Time, BGP Identifier e outros parâmetros opcionais que estabelecem os recursos da sessão “session capabilities”.
O atributo Hold Time define o Hold Timer em segundos para cada vizinho BGP. Após o recebimento de um UPDATE ou KEEPALIVE, o Hold Timer é redefinido para o valor inicial. Se o Hold Timer chegar a zero, a sessão BGP é interrompida, as rotas a partir desse vizinho são removidas e uma mensagem de update é enviada para os vizinhos que podem ser afetados.
O Hold Time é um mecanismo de pulsação “teste” para vizinhos do BGP para garantir que o vizinho esteja íntegro e vivo. Ao estabelecer uma sessão BGP, os roteadores usam o menor valor Hold Time contido nas mensagens OPEN dos dois roteadores. O valor do Hold Time deve ser de pelo menos três segundos ou zero (não recomendo muito baixo para evitar flaping das rotas, queda constantes da sessão BGP; se você tem só uma operadora não tem necessidade mudar este valor, se você tem 2 operadoras ai eu gosto de colocar 30s e o Keepalive 10s. O valor default do MikroTik Huawei e Cisco é 180 segundos.
2 – UPDATE – A mensagem de atualização anuncia quaisquer rotas viáveis, retira as rotas anunciadas anteriormente ou pode fazer as duas coisas. A mensagem de atualização inclui o Network Layer Reachability Information (NLRI) que inclui o prefixo e BGP PAs associados ao anunciar prefixos. Os NLRIs retirados incluem apenas o prefixo. Uma mensagem UPDATE pode atuar como um Keepalive para reduzir o tráfego desnecessário.
3 – NOTIFICATION – A mensagem NOTIFICATION (mensagem de notificação) é enviada quando um erro é detectado com a sessão do BGP, como um hold time expirado, alteração de recursos do vizinho ou uma redefinição da sessão do BGP é solicitada. Isso faz com que a conexão BGP seja fechada.
4 – KEEPALIVE – O BGP não depende do estado da conexão TCP para garantir que os vizinhos ainda estejam ativos. As mensagens Keepalive são trocadas a cada um terço do Hold Timer acordado entre os dois roteadores BGP. Os dispositivos MikroTIk, Huawei e Cisco têm um Hold Time padrão de 180 segundos, então o intervalo Keepalive padrão é 60 segundos. Se o Hold Time for definido como zero, nenhuma mensagem Keepalive será enviada entre os roteadores BGP.
Posts recentes
- O que é MVRP implementando no RouterOS v7.14 MikroTik?
- Como fazer filtros de BGP no RouterOS v7 | Leonardo Vieira
- COMO RECUPERAR A SENHA DA CONTROLADORA UNIFI NO WINDOWS | LEONARDO VIEIRA
- COMO USAR COMANDOS NO MIKROTIK ROUTEROS V7 – CLI | LEONARDO VIEIRA
- COMO DHCP DO MIKROTIK PODE FAZER O CONTROLE DE BANDA AUTOMATICO | LEONARDO VIEIRA
Comentários
- Anônimo em Failover de Link Internet PPPoE com aviso automático no Telegram
- Bit One em MATERIAL PARA ALUNOS MTCRE
- Igor em No-IP no MikroTik
- Marco Aurélio Santos de Melo em MTCNA Turma 06.2024
- Marco Aurélio Santos de Melo em MATERIAL PARA ALUNOS MTCNA
0 responses on "Tipos de Mensagem BGP - Tópico Certificação MTCINE e HCIP"